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77313503900 305 063558 1844 44
39483623 25770587 468
39483623 25770587 468
115 3121104 967863
All about undefined
Interested in learning more?
39483623 25770587 468
115 3121104 967863
See more
32 1944
1354512373 54999 1698821729 621364 980
See more
36467 5633729239 42230476
814 72761767192 2710
See more